Output 66cc37d7cb94736d4c08df2c03fb387a988fbdcb86490450ed4612de3e45e439:2

value
1052768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fcd15f016e0db1372b0b57f8b3ea1b99d386998 OP_EQUAL
address
3LdmUrddQCX5ygXEm2D6tX6yQjbfdrRAZv
transaction
66cc37d7cb94736d4c08df2c03fb387a988fbdcb86490450ed4612de3e45e439